Each week I will share with you a Web 2.0 tool that is free, easy to learn and can easily be adapted into your classroom. This week we will look at a newspaper clipping generator. All you need to do is enter text and click on 'generate' to create your clipping. Here is an example of what it looks like:How can you use this in the classroom?
- You can create a newspaper clipping identifying students who did a great job on a quiz, or the class as a whole that did well. Simply post it on your Epson when they come to class.
- Have students write a newspaper article based on historical events and then send them to this site to publish
